Well i bought a new sp 600, and to say the truth I dont think it rides as good as my straight axle magnum 500. It is way to stiff, you hit a rock or bump and it throws the machine up in the air (not soaking it up) The preload is as loose as it goes.....I weigh 150lbs but that shouldnt matter much......I know it is new machine but will it get smoother as the machine brakes in???? it has about 20 hrs and 100 miles and it is still very very stiff.....guess i was just expecting a better ride with the independent rear like everyone says it is.........the front rides real good though....
